Wikipedia article




'Death Sentence' is a 1968 Spaghetti Western directed by Mario Lanfranchi and starring Richard Conte.

Plot



The rancher Diaz, the gambler Montero, the hypocrite clergyman Baldwin and the mentally distorted rover O'Hara are all former bandits. Cash has unfinished business with this lot and for each single one he conceives a tailored trap which turns their individual preferences against them until they are all put down.
